Applying For Funding

We want to hear from registered charitable trusts and not-for-profit organisations committed to delivering projects or initiatives that will enhance the lives of people in Auckland and Northland.

Boundary mapTo be considered for funding an organisation must be:

  • An incorporated society, or a charitable trust that has been registered for at least 12 months
  • Controlled by an organisation operating under an adopted constitution and rules
  • Within the Trust's region.

If you are applying for funding for a new project, or you have never applied to ASB Community Trust before, it is important that you talk to us before filling in an application form.

Audited accounts

Where an organisation is applying for $40,000 or more, a copy of your most recent audited annual accounts must be included with your application. If your organisation is applying for less than $40,000 you only need to supply the most recent annual accounts, signed by two office holders.
Please note that if your organisation’s constitution requires it to have audited accounts, you will still have to include audited accounts with your application. 

Boundaries

The Trust's southern boundary is from Port Waikato Head following the Waikato River to the Whangamarino River, then along the Whangamarino River, before following the Mangatangi Stream to where it adjoins Mangatangi Road. The boundary then runs from the corner of Monument and Miranda Roads straight to Miranda. Our region covers all areas north of this, up to Cape Reinga and including the islands in the Hauraki Gulf.

Those organisations that fall outside the boundaries of our region will be considered to the extent that they provide benefit to our region
